When we think about internal stability we first think of animals. But all organisms must maintain internal stability or homeosta

sis. When plants are under water stress they respond in a way to conserve the internal water. How would leafy plants respond to temporary water stress? (A)Develop a thick waxy cuticle, (B)Leaves wilt and photosynthesis temporarily stops, (C)Stomata stay open to help draw water up from the roots of the plants, (D) Stomata open less frequently to restrict transpiration and conserve water.
Biology
1 answer:
AnnyKZ [126]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

In water stres stomata open less frequently to restrict transpiration and conserve water.

Explanation:

In response to a water deficit stress, water transport systems across membranes function to control turgor pressure changes in guard cells and stimulate stomatal closure.

When too much water has accumulated
aliya0001 [1]

Answer:

<em>Too much water accumulation leads to a condition called as water intoxication.</em>

Explanation:

Drinking too much water leads to a condition called water intoxication or water poisoning. This happens because the concentration of water becomes such abundant in a person's body that it dilutes the concentration of electrolytes like sodium in the blood. This causes a disruption in the functioning of the brain hence leading to the death of the person. Various such scenarios have been observed in athletes drinking too much water.

Compare and contrast infertility and erectile dysfunction. What are the possible causes and treatments of each?
Korolek [52]

Infertility is the incapacity to conceive an offspring while erectile dysfunction is the incapacity to get aroused so as to engage in sexual intercourse (mostly in men).

Erectile dysfunction could be caused by stress, cardiovascular diseases, and diabetes. Therefore treating it requires maintaining a healthy lifestyle of nutrition and exercise.

Infertility can be caused by disorders of reproductive organs such as endometriosis and occlusion in the tubes. This can be treated by assisted reproduction (IVF), corrective surgery and education.
